In brief
- The University of Silicon Valley is offering scholarships of up to $15,000 for students with exceptional gaming achievements.
- The scholarships are split into two tiers: Mastery and Legendary, worth $2,500 and $5,000 per term respectively.
- Students must hit specific in-game milestones in popular games like Final Fantasy XIV and Minecraft to qualify.
